[QUOTE="timoyz, post: 219222, member: 10"] From a ex Yamaha R&D guy I've talked to, the transmissions in the 4 pokes are very weak, and they had to give up starting them in gear on the dyno because they tended to explode. Personally, my '07 has gone through 2 transmissions. The 4th to 5th fork bends slightly, and doesn't travel the gear far enough, taking out the cogs. That is a $800 parts rebuild. Not to give you bad juju, just sayin'. [/QUOTE]
